Thomas Joe Schmidt Obituary

It is with great sadness that we announce the death of Thomas Joe Schmidt of Vandalia, Missouri, who passed away on March 3, 2025, at the age of 71, leaving to mourn family and friends.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of Thomas Joe Schmidt to pay them a last tribute.

He was predeceased by: his parents, John Albert and Evelyn Schmidt (Wilson); his stepmother Emma Schmidt; his daughter Maggie Schmidt; and his brother Ronald Schmidt.

He is survived by: his daughters, Genille Schmidt (Dane Gearhart) of Hermann, Missouri and Kayla Schmidt (Steve Butler) of Vandalia, Missouri; his sisters, Connie Smith of Jefferson City, Missouri, Linda Napier of Hermann, Missouri and Sandy Beckwith of Orlando, Florida; his grandchildren, Kaitlin Wells (Ryan Teague), Devon Gearhart, Mina, Elyza, Auria Williams and Isla Butler; and his great grandchildren, Oaklynn, Oliver Flowers and Tucker Teague. He is also survived by aunts, uncles nieces, nephews and cousins.

Memorials may be given to Big Spring Cemetery.
